FOXP3 inhibits MYC expression via regulating miR‐198 and influences cell viability, proliferation and cell apoptosis in HepG2
OBJECTIVE: Our study aimed to explore the effects of FOXP3 expression on liver neoplasms cells and to further investigate the relationship between FOXP3 and proto‐oncogene MYC.
